Dodgex1 Posted August 6, 2008 Posted August 6, 2008 (edited) Users are either author, editor or publisher. Authors can login in the front end and submit an article which you then have to approve and publish via admin back end. Editors can submit new articles and change exsisting articles, would need you to confirm submissions again. Publishers can submit and publish articles without your permission. If you set someone to be the author of a particular article then they will be able to edit that article aswell as submitting new ones. Joomla Docs Massive Joomla related wiki should help.
